The Forgotten 500 Summary of Key Points

The Forgotten 500 is a gripping true story about a daring World War II rescue mission. It gives a detailed account of Operation Halyard, a secret mission that rescued over 500 American airmen stranded in Nazi-occupied Serbia. The book tells the tale of these men’s courage and the extraordinary efforts of the Serbian villagers who risked their lives to help them.

Born a Crime Summary of Key Points

Born a Crime is the autobiography of Trevor Noah, a South African comedian and current host of The Daily Show. Trevor describes his childhood as a mixed-race child under Apartheid, highlighting the absurdities of the system. He showcases his mother’s strength, resilience and fierce love as she raises him amidst uncertainty and danger.
